Forecasters warn that we could see lightning and hail storms this week as temperatures rise during a mini-heatwave. Parts of the country are experiencing highs of up to 21C, but according to the Met Office disruptive weather is on its way.The UK is set to be hit with “lively” weather as things become unsettled.

Met Office meteorologist Aidan McGivern told the Daily Express: "There will be hail and thunder, and they will be quite lively things. "Where we get sunny spells, it will feel quite warm and there will be a noticeable difference in the east. "As warmth from the southwest makes its way towards the UK...

we could get 21C towards the south and the southeast." It’s set to be damp on Friday with a band of rain making its way across the country.

However the outlook for the rest of the month is a lot brighter, with bookmakers predicting it will be the warmest May ever.
